    Hello! After thinking this idea up before going to bed, I just HAD to put it somewhere.

    SO! Black holes, here's my idea of how they'd work in-game...

    It appears in the place of a random star (most likely temperate stars) in a radius around the ship every few hours, and when it appears, a massive supernova cloud'll expand for a while before dissipating, that's your reminder that basically says "hey, a star just blew up, go get yourself some sick loot."

    When a hole appears, nearby system's planets will get snatched away by the black hole (unless you've built a colony/placed crafting stations and/or storage items on said planet). Then a timer of 30 minutes begins before the planet enters the event horizon, also, planet's materials will be messed up (ores could be smushed together by the gravity from the hole to make mixed ores, which, when smelted create alloys.)

    About the timer, as it decreases, the planet will rumble more and more, sometimes ripping chunks of the planet off, until, if you're on the planet to experience the event horizon, a cinematic will play out of the player giving up and kneeling down as all the blocks fall up and deteriorate.

    When the player respawns after a black hole death, they'll be inflicted with the status effect "Trauma" where the player gets item names/icons/descriptions all mixed up for 1.5 minutes, for example, you might start whacking an enemy with a bowl of salve, or you might stab yourself trying to heal with a dagger.

    Hope you all enjoy my suggestion, oh, by the way, the ruin biome theme (or any other intense song of choice) plays when the counter has 5 minutes left.
